BTi's Severe Weather Attendant continuously monitors your station's selected National Weather Service (NWS) Weather Forecast Offices (WFO) for active weather alerts and broadcasts hazardous weather warnings in English and Spanish for your DMA. Display maps, radar (if available), and alert text to provide clear, concise information to viewers.

Severe Weather Attendant extracts pertinent emergency weather information from NWS alert feeds issued by your station's designated Weather Forecast Office and displays warnings on air, online, and on mobile devices for counties within your selected DMA. Provide designated administrators with alerts through emailed push notifications or internal alarms based on Alert Severity Codes, enabling them to review and approve alerts prior to airing.
Severe Weather Attendant interfaces with NWS CAP (Common Alerting Protocol) feeds, ATOM/RSS alert services, and a wide variety of satellite, web, and wire service receiving systems — ensuring your station never misses a warning from local and national monitored field offices.
